QUOTE (poopshovel @ Apr 2 2006, 04:31 AM)
QUOTE
Driveshafts arrived yesterday and fit like a glove.


Did you keep the civic hubs and have custom shafts made?



We used integra da3 hubs and had custom shafts made by circuit worx. The car was tuned adjusting timing and fuel (no cam advance on current map as yet) for an hour and a half and it spat out 181 whp on a low reading dyno dynamics dyno. Lots left in it. Hitting the road with the car bad luck struck twice. First thirty seconds on the road we blew a CV. When replacing it we realised the mounts had sagged and the CV boots on both sides were rubbing on the control arms. And the rear mount let the engine move too much. We decided to try our luck as it was only just rubbing. Luck was not on our side. Just leaving to go to the track the rear engine mount snapped in turn letting the engine rock back and forth, resulting in the right hand shaft popping out of the gear box. The car is now back at the engineers workshop getting the engine raised and modifying mounts to suit at no cost. Could take a couple of weeks.
The positives. This is now the fastest car I've ever been in. The K20 in a 1560 pound car is fast. Can't wait to drive it again fully tuned.

Hey guys haven't been on for a while.

We made it out to the track a week and a half ago. On its first and only pass I ran a 12.96 @ 110 MPH on a 2.020 60ft with the car spinning all through first and half of second with slow shits. Then on it's second pass after lowering the launch control from 5500 rpm to 5000rpm we broke both outer CV's at the hubs. We've since gone out to the track after replacing the CV's and broke another left hand outer CV on the first run of the night (making it 4 cv's that have died trying on the car). We have now put in brand new OEM items instead of the cheap crap standard replacements from the local driveline shop.
